In many resorts, they can lease out their week or provide it as a present to family and friends. Used as the basis for drawing in mass interest acquiring a timeshare, is the concept of owners exchanging their week, either separately or through exchange companies. The 2 largestoften mentioned in mediaare RCI and Interval International (II), which combined, have over 7,000 resorts. They have resort affiliate programs, and members can only exchange with affiliated resorts. It is most common for a resort to be affiliated with only one of the larger exchange firms, although resorts with double affiliations are not unusual.

RCI and II charge a yearly subscription charge, and additional costs for when they discover an exchange for a requesting member, and bar members from leasing weeks for which they currently have exchanged. Owners can likewise exchange their weeks or points through independent exchange companies. Owners can exchange without needing the resort to have an official association contract with the business, if the resort of ownership accepts such arrangements in the original contract. Due to the promise of exchange, timeshares typically sell regardless of the place of their deeded resort. What is rarely disclosed is the distinction in trading power depending upon the place, and season of the ownership.

Nevertheless, timeshares in highly desirable places and high season time slots are the most costly in the world, based on demand common of any heavily trafficked holiday location. An individual who owns a timeshare in the American desert neighborhood of Palm Springs, California in the middle of July or August will possess a much reduced capability to exchange time, https://laneqiag532.skyrock.com/3347287190-What-Does-Timeshare-Mean-Can-Be-Fun-For-Everyone.html because fewer concerned a resort at a time when the temperature levels remain in excess of 110 F (43 C). A major difference in types of holiday ownership is in between deeded and right-to-use agreements. With deeded contracts making use of the resort is generally divided into week-long increments and are sold as genuine home through fractional ownership.

The owner is likewise liable for an equal part of the property tax, which usually are collected with condo maintenance costs. The owner can potentially subtract some property-related costs, such as property tax from gross income. Deeded ownership can be as complex as outright residential or commercial property ownership in that the structure of deeds differ according to regional home laws. Leasehold deeds are common and deal ownership for a set duration of time after which the ownership goes back to the freeholder. Periodically, leasehold deeds are provided in eternity, nevertheless lots of deeds do not communicate ownership of the land, however simply the apartment or condo or system (housing) of the accommodation.

Therefore, a right-to-use agreement grants the right to use the resort for a specific variety of years. In many nations there are severe limits on foreign property ownership; hence, this is a common technique for developing resorts in nations such as Mexico. Care must be taken with this type of ownership as the right to use frequently takes the kind of a club membership or the right to use the booking system, where the reservation system is owned by a business not in the control of the owners. The right to use might be lost with the demise of the controlling business, since a right to use purchaser's agreement is usually just excellent with the current owner, and if that owner offers the residential or commercial property, the lease holder might be out of luck depending on the structure of the contract, and/or existing laws in foreign locations.

An owner may own a deed to use an unit for a single specific week; for example, week 51 generally includes Christmas. An individual who owns Week 26 at a resort can use just that week in each year. In some cases units are offered as floating weeks, in which an agreement specifies the number of weeks held by each owner and from which weeks the owner might choose for his stay. An example of this might be a floating summer week, in which the owner might choose any single week throughout the summertime. In such a circumstance, there is most likely to be higher competitors throughout weeks including vacations, while lower competition is likely when schools are still in session.
